Building Energy Management System

Researchers at Empa are advancing the development of sophisticated building energy management systems that integrate the thermal management requirements of IT equipment with the broader demands of building-wide HVAC systems. Their methodology employs state-of-the-art, data-driven controllers, which facilitate efficient and scalable implementation across a variety of building types. By harnessing real-time data from IT infrastructure, occupancy patterns, and environmental sensors, these systems dynamically optimize energy consumption, effectively balancing operational costs with occupant comfort.

A central innovation lies in the application of predictive control algorithms, which forecast energy demand and proactively adjust building operations to maintain consistent and reliable performance. This comprehensive approach significantly enhances the efficiency of thermal energy management within modern buildings. The overarching goal of this research is to demonstrate that intelligent, automated building energy management systems are fundamental to achieving sustainable and resilient infrastructure for the future.
